​
DirectorySecurity Advisories
Sign In
Security Advisories

CGA-h89x-6j2c-g28c

Published

Last updated

https://images.chainguard.dev/security/CGA-h89x-6j2c-g28c
Package

k9s

Latest Update
Fixed
Fixed Version

0.31.8-r0

Aliases
  • CVE-2024-24579
  • GHSA-hpxr-w9w7-g4gv

Severity

5.3

Medium

CVSS V3

Summary

stereoscope vulnerable to tar path traversal when processing OCI tar archives

Description

Impact

It is possible to craft an OCI tar archive that, when stereoscope attempts to unarchive the contents, will result in writing to paths outside of the unarchive temporary directory. Specifically, use of github.com/anchore/stereoscope/pkg/file.UntarToDirectory() function, the github.com/anchore/stereoscope/pkg/image/oci.TarballImageProvider struct, or the higher level github.com/anchore/stereoscope/pkg/image.Image.Read() function express this vulnerability.

Patches

Patched in v0.0.1

Workarounds

If you are using the OCI archive as input into stereoscope then you can switch to using an OCI layout by unarchiving the tar archive and provide the unarchived directory to stereoscope.

References

References

Updates


Safe Source for Open Sourceâ„¢
Media KitContact Us
© 2024 Chainguard. All Rights Reserved.
Private PolicyTerms of Use

Product

Chainguard Images